Merthyr Tydfil sits at the head of the Taff Valley. It is a place where industrial grit meets mountain air. My top tip is to visit the grounds of Cyfarthfa Castle. You can walk the paths and see the lake for free. This is a prime choice for a low cost day out. The stone arches of the Cefn Coed Viaduct tower over the river. You can ride the steam train from Pant to see the hills. The Taff Trail offers a flat path for a long walk. Red kites fly high above the old ironworks. The town has deep roots in the story of coal.
